package org.geosdi.geoplatform.gui.model.tree;
import com.extjs.gxt.ui.client.data.ModelData;
import com.google.common.collect.Maps;
import org.geosdi.geoplatform.gui.configuration.composite.GPTreeCompositeType;
import org.geosdi.geoplatform.gui.configuration.map.client.layer.GPFolderClientInfo;
import org.geosdi.geoplatform.gui.configuration.map.client.layer.IGPFolderElements;
import org.geosdi.geoplatform.gui.model.GPLayerBean;
import org.geosdi.geoplatform.gui.model.tree.visitor.IVisitor;
import org.geosdi.geoplatform.gui.observable.Observable;
import java.util.Iterator;
import java.util.List;
import java.util.Map;
public abstract class AbstractFolderTreeNode extends GPBeanTreeModel
implements GPCompositeTreeModelConverter<IGPFolderElements> {
private static final long serialVersionUID = 4886440607031207404L;
//
private ObservableFolderTreeNode observable = new ObservableFolderTreeNode();
protected int numberOfDescendants = 0;
private boolean loaded = Boolean.FALSE;
public enum GPFolderKeyValue {
LABEL("label");
//
private String value;
GPFolderKeyValue(String theValue) {
this.value = theValue;
}
@Override
public String toString() {
return this.value;
}
}
protected AbstractFolderTreeNode() {
}
protected AbstractFolderTreeNode(GPFolderClientInfo folder) {
super(folder.getId(), folder.getLabel(), folder.getzIndex(),
folder.isChecked());
}
@Override
public void accept(IVisitor visitor) {
visitor.visitFolder(this);
}
@Override
public void setLabel(String label) {
super.setLabel(label);
super.set(GPFolderKeyValue.LABEL.toString(), label);
}
@Override
public GPTreeCompositeType getTreeCompositeType() {
return GPTreeCompositeType.COMPOSITE;
}
/**
* @return the number of childrens
*/
public int getNumberOfDescendants() {
return numberOfDescendants;
}
/**
* @param numberOfChildrens the numberOfChildrens to set
*/
public void setNumberOfDescendants(int numberOfChildrens) {
this.numberOfDescendants = numberOfChildrens;
}
/**
* @return the loaded
*/
public boolean isLoaded() {
return loaded;
}
/**
* @param loaded the loaded to set
*/
public void setLoaded(boolean loaded) {
this.loaded = loaded;
}
/**
* The Folder Child as a Map
*
* @return Map<String, GPLayerBean>
*/
public Map<String, GPLayerBean> getLayers() {
Map<String, GPLayerBean> childMap = Maps.newHashMap();
List<ModelData> childList = super.getChildren();
for (Iterator<ModelData> it = childList.iterator(); it.hasNext(); ) {
ModelData model = it.next();
if (model instanceof GPLayerBean) {
childMap.put(((GPLayerBean) model).getLabel(),
(GPLayerBean) model);
}
}
return childMap;
}
@Override
public void setId(Long id) {
super.setId(id);
observable.setChanged();
observable.notifyObservers(id);
}
public ObservableFolderTreeNode getObservable() {
return observable;
}
public void setObservable(ObservableFolderTreeNode observable) {
this.observable = observable;
}
/**
* @return {@link Boolean}
*/
public abstract boolean isExpanded();
public class ObservableFolderTreeNode extends Observable {
@Override
protected synchronized void setChanged() {
super.setChanged();
}
}
}
